📝 Ingredients
Water, Soybean Oil, Modified Corn Starch, Egg Whites, Soy Flour, Wheat Gluten, Hydrolyzed Corn Protein, Contains 2% or Less of Vegetable Glycerin, Salt, Soy Protein Isolate, Sodium Citrate, Sodium Phosphate, Sugar, Yeast, Caramel Color, Natural and Artificial Flavors, Monocalcium Phosphate, Sodium Tripolyphosphate, Malic Acid, Hydrolyzed Soy Protein, Guar Gum, Lactic Acid, Hydrolyzed Wheat Protein, Yeast Extract, Spice, Locust Bean Gum, Sodium Sulfite (for Freshness), Disodium Inosinate, Disodium Guanylate, Carrageenan, Red 3, Nonfat Milk, Yellow 6, Citric Acid. Vitamins and Minerals: Niacinamide, Iron (ferrous Sulfate), Vitamin B1 (thiamin Mononitrate), Vitamin B6 (pyridoxine Hydrochloride), Vitamin B2 (riboflavin), Vitamin B12.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Veggie Bacon Strips
Is Veggie Bacon Strips good for weight loss?
At 60 calories per strip with minimal carbs and sugar, veggie bacon strips can fit into a weight loss plan as an occasional protein-boosting snack. However, the sodium content is fairly high at 220mg per serving, so moderation is still important.
Is Veggie Bacon Strips a good snack for kids?
Veggie bacon strips can be a decent option for kids since they're low in calories and provide some protein and iron. The texture and bacon-like flavor may appeal to children, though the high sodium and artificial colors might be a consideration for some families.
Is Veggie Bacon Strips suitable for people with lactose intolerance?
This product contains nonfat milk in the ingredients list, so it's not suitable for people with lactose intolerance.
Is Veggie Bacon Strips gluten-free?
No, this product is not gluten-free. The ingredient list includes wheat gluten and hydrolyzed wheat protein.
